Transpersonal Hypnosis uses hypnosis techniques to help people explore not only their thoughts, feelings, and behaviors but also to move into the deeper, spiritual side of their lives. The word transpersonal means “beyond the personal,” so this approach looks at the whole person — mind, body, emotions, and spirit.
Transpersonal hypnosis is a holistic, spiritually-centered therapeutic approach that moves beyond traditional symptom-focused therapy to address the integration of mind, body, and spirit. It uses altered states, such as the hypnotic states, to access deeper, "beyond the ego" levels of consciousness, facilitating personal growth, healing, and the exploration of transpersonal experiences like past-life regression.
Transpersonal Hypnosis uses a more holistic approach, it engages the whole person, including the spiritual aspects, to achieve inner harmony. It works with core beliefs, operating on the premise that all individuals are interconnected, and that healing comes from expanding self-awareness and transcending limiting beliefs.
Spiritual Hypnosis is also known and referred to as Transpersonal Hypnosis. That is because it is based on the same core principles as Transpersonal Psychology. Transpersonal psychology is built on four fundamental premises. These principles guide the healing process and distinguish this approach from other forms of more traditional therapy.

Some of the techniques might be guided imagery, meditation, mindfulness, and techniques that explore spiritual, mystical, Past Life regression, or Spiritual Regression Journeys. It can be used for reducing anxiety, boosting self-esteem, addressing irrational fears, and exploring life purpose or spiritual growth.
The primary aim is to support the client as they create a stronger sense of wholeness and connection to a deeper, inner, or universal wisdom. Unlike traditional hypnosis, which often focuses on behavioral modification, transpersonal hypnosis focuses on the client's spiritual journey and personal transformation.
